In electrolysis, the process of oxidation occurs at the: (2023)
  • Step 1: Understand what electrolysis is. It is a process that uses electricity to cause a chemical change.
  • Step 2: Identify the two main parts of an electrolysis setup: the anode and the cathode.
  • Step 3: Know that oxidation is a chemical reaction where a substance loses electrons.
  • Step 4: Remember that oxidation occurs at the anode during electrolysis.
  • Step 5: Conclude that in electrolysis, the anode is where oxidation takes place.
  • Electrolysis – Electrolysis is a chemical process that uses electricity to drive a non-spontaneous reaction, involving the movement of ions in an electrolyte.
  • Oxidation and Reduction – In electrochemical reactions, oxidation is the loss of electrons, while reduction is the gain of electrons. Oxidation occurs at the anode and reduction at the cathode.
  • Anode and Cathode – The anode is the electrode where oxidation occurs, and the cathode is where reduction takes place during electrolysis.
